At least five dead as bus plunges into Tamakoshi river in Ramechhap

Ramechhap
A passenger bus operated by Araniko Yatayat, travelling from Kathmandu to Okhaldhunga, fell into the Tamakoshi river near Lilauti in ward 6 of Manthali Municipality in Ramechhap on Tuesday, killing at least five people.
Police Inspector Rajan Prasad Timilsina of the District Police Office, Ramechhap, confirmed that five bodies, including the bus owner, have been recovered.
Residents, security personnel, and rescue teams are helping evacuate the injured. So far, three people have been rescued and sent for treatment.
Efforts to recover others trapped in the bus continue. Police said the cause of the accident is under investigation.
